What is Conversion Risk Analysis AI for?+

It helps growth, product marketing, and funnel teams diagnose likely conversion blockers across traffic quality, landing page claims, offer clarity, trust proof, CTA hesitation, pricing, and checkout steps.

How is conversion risk analysis different from forecasting conversion rate?+

Forecast Conversion Rate estimates how conversion may move. Conversion Risk Analysis focuses on why conversion may fail, which blockers matter most, and what evidence or page changes should be fixed first.

What inputs work best for conversion risk analysis?+

Use a landing page, funnel map, analytics note, ad concept, offer brief, pricing change, checkout concern, user feedback, or experiment result with the target conversion event clearly stated.

What should teams do with the conversion risk report?+

Use it to prioritize landing page fixes, proof assets, offer copy, CTA tests, pricing explanations, checkout cleanup, and follow-up experiments before scaling traffic.
